Russian Qt Forum
Ноябрь 23, 2024, 19:15
Добро пожаловать,
Гость
. Пожалуйста,
войдите
или
зарегистрируйтесь
.
Вам не пришло
письмо с кодом активации?
1 час
1 день
1 неделя
1 месяц
Навсегда
Войти
Начало
Форум
WIKI (Вики)
FAQ
Помощь
Поиск
Войти
Регистрация
Russian Qt Forum
>
Forum
>
Qt
>
Общие вопросы
>
Qt: FAQ о лицензии. Commercial vs Opensource
Страниц:
1
...
10
11
[
12
]
13
14
...
30
Вниз
« предыдущая тема
следующая тема »
Печать
Автор
Тема: Qt: FAQ о лицензии. Commercial vs Opensource (Прочитано 354544 раз)
Dimchansky
Гость
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#165 :
Май 22, 2007, 11:27 »
Цитата: "Racheengel"
Вот давайте так. Делаю я опенсорс-проект. На халявной версии, естественно. И поскольку это опенсорс - он доступен БЕСПЛАТНО. То есть народ ходит, качает, сообщает о багах (у самих троллей ТАКОЙ ЖЕ ПОДХОД). Что плохого в том, что я развиваю свой опенсорс проект?
Опенсорс проект ты развиваешь и это хорошо. Но тут дело в другом.
Если бы ты делал опенсорс проект,
в который не входил бы ни один модуль под GPL лицензией
, то любую следующую версию своей программы ты бы мог закрыть спокойно. Те версии, что ты уже выпустил в опенсорс, ты не можешь закрывать.
Но ты делаешь проект, в который входит библиотека, выпущеная по GPL лицензии, поэтому ты автоматом обрекаешь все свои версии программы на то, что все её производные версии будут
вечно
под GPL лицензией, т.к. ты не являешься автором тех GPL модулей, которые ты использовал. Это такая вот юридическая заморочка. Хочется нам того или нет, но таковы правила игры.
Поэтому, когда ты решаешь перевести такую программу под коммерческую лицензию, ты нарушаешь GPL лицензию, которая не позволяет переводить любые производные версии программы в закрытый продукт, если ты не являешься автором всей программы, а ты им не являешься, т.к. используешь GPL библиотеку от Qt.
Цитировать
Но приходит момент, когда я вижу, что его реально начали юзать. Народу нужны новые и новые фичи. Я понимаю, что вечно делать на халяву я его не смогу - время, деньги, то-се. Поэтому то, что сделано до этого - оставляю халявными. А вот более навороченные релизы я уже хочу сделать коммерческими. Поэтому я покупаю у Троллей лицензию и делаю коммерческую ветку проекта. Объясните мне, в чем тут преступление и как это вредит Троллтеку?
Преступление в нарушении правил игры - законов GPL лицензии.
Я не знаю, насколько это вредит тролям, может быть и не вредит. Но правила установлены и мы можем либо соглашаться и использовать, либо не соглашаться и не использовать. Мне тоже не нравятся такие правила.
Цитировать
Ну во первых, за еду они не работают, поскольку доходы компании весьма немаленькие. Они бы не занимались оперорсовыми релизами, если б это не было им выгодно - бесплатная реклама, отлов багов, новые идеи и фичи, опять же миграция юзеров с других тулкитов.
Это вопрос морали и этики, но не законов. Мы говорим о законности того или иного поступка по бумагам.
Цитировать
Разница есть. Я хочу попробовать продукт, прежде чем покупать. А вдруг там баг на баге?
Вот они и дают тебе пробную версию, чтобы ты попробовал. Evaluation.
Цитировать
Цитировать
пока наконец опенсорсник не расщедрится и не скажет, ну вот, эти фичи меня устраивают, покупаю?
Глупо было бы покупать тулкит, который клиента не устраивает, верно?
Клиента по большому счёту не интересует, что ты используешь из тулкитов, ему главное, чтобы результат был и он был законен, а не украден.
Записан
Racheengel
Джедай : наставник для всех
Offline
Сообщений: 2679
Я работал с дискетам 5.25 :(
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#166 :
Май 22, 2007, 11:44 »
Цитировать
Поэтому, когда ты решаешь перевести такую программу под коммерческую лицензию, ты нарушаешь GPL лицензию, которая не позволяет переводить любые производные версии программы в закрытый продукт, если ты не являешься автором всей программы, а ты им не являешься, т.к. используешь GPL библиотеку от Qt.
Стоп. То, что я сделал под GPL версией Qt - оно так и осталось халявным. Лежит себе в сырцах на сайте.
Но я купил коммерческую лицензию. То есть я уже не юзаю GPL для того проекта, который хочу закрыть. Qt - лицензионная. А остальные сырцы - мои, я являюсь их автором. Я имею полное право делать с моими исходниками то, что хочу. В том числе собрать их с другой библиотекой...
Вообще, я тоже противник всякого рода лицензий, и считаю, что софт - такой же товар, как, допустим, табуретка. А поэтому он должен продаваться на тех же основаниях.
Записан
What is the 11 in the C++11? It’s the number of feet they glued to C++ trying to obtain a better octopus.
COVID не волк, в лес не уйдёт
Dimchansky
Гость
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#167 :
Май 22, 2007, 17:34 »
Цитата: "Racheengel"
Стоп. То, что я сделал под GPL версией Qt - оно так и осталось халявным. Лежит себе в сырцах на сайте.
Но я купил коммерческую лицензию. То есть я уже не юзаю GPL для того проекта, который хочу закрыть. Qt - лицензионная. А остальные сырцы - мои, я являюсь их автором. Я имею полное право делать с моими исходниками то, что хочу. В том числе собрать их с другой библиотекой...
Нужно всё-таки внимательно прочитать тексты лицензий от Trolltech для Qt Open Source и Qt Commercial.
добавлено спустя 3 часа 37 минут:
Пока поверхностно ознакомился с текстами лицензий. Не нашёл ничего такого, что нарушало бы какой-то пункт лицензий. Может плохо смотрел.
Обратился к представителям Trolltech, после эмоционального разговора, в котором мне было сказно, что я хочу найти лазейку, чтобы их обмануть, мне всё-таки пообщали сообщить, что именно я нарушаю.
Пока что у меня складывается впечатление, что они просто хотят убедить меня платить сейчас, а не потом. А, т.к. они являются продавцами коммерческой версии, то, в случае, если они узнают, что кто-то делал что-то на OpenSource длительное время, не продадут коммерческую лицензию до тех пор, пока вы не оплатите весь период использования OpenSource "в коммерческих целях".
Записан
kitov
Гость
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#168 :
Май 22, 2007, 20:02 »
Цитата: "Racheengel"
Вот давайте так. Делаю я опенсорс-проект. На халявной версии, естественно. И поскольку это опенсорс - он доступен БЕСПЛАТНО.
Почему бесплатно ? Свободно .
Ты можешь продавть свою программу , но обязан прилагать
исходники (GPL) .
И если код под GPL , то переходя на коммерческую версию
ты не должен делать его закрытым .
Переписывай.
Записан
Dimchansky
Гость
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#169 :
Май 22, 2007, 20:09 »
Цитата: "kitov"
Ты можешь продавть свою программу , но обязан прилагать
исходники (GPL) .
И если код под GPL , то переходя на коммерческую версию
ты не должен делать его закрытым .
Переписывай.
По-моему, GPL не запрещает автору программы менять вид лицензии на своё детище. При условии, что он не использует чужых GPL модулей.
Записан
kitov
Гость
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#170 :
Май 22, 2007, 22:09 »
Цитата: "Dimchansky"
Цитата: "kitov"
Ты можешь продавть свою программу , но обязан прилагать
исходники (GPL) .
И если код под GPL , то переходя на коммерческую версию
ты не должен делать его закрытым .
Переписывай.
По-моему, GPL не запрещает автору программы менять вид лицензии на своё детище. При условии, что он не использует чужых GPL модулей.
Путаешь с BSD .
добавлено спустя 2 минуты:
Нет , ошибаюсь .
Если используется только твой , личный код , то разумеется
можно брать любую лицензию.
Записан
Racheengel
Джедай : наставник для всех
Offline
Сообщений: 2679
Я работал с дискетам 5.25 :(
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#171 :
Май 22, 2007, 22:37 »
Цитировать
братился к представителям Trolltech, после эмоционального разговора, в котором мне было сказно, что я хочу найти лазейку, чтобы их обмануть, мне всё-таки пообщали сообщить, что именно я нарушаю.
Пока что у меня складывается впечатление, что они просто хотят убедить меня платить сейчас, а не потом. А, т.к. они являются продавцами коммерческой версии, то, в случае, если они узнают, что кто-то делал что-то на OpenSource длительное время, не продадут коммерческую лицензию до тех пор, пока вы не оплатите весь период использования OpenSource "в коммерческих целях".
Ну, естественно - в их интересах вытрясти с тебя как можно больше денег
А вот за оплату опенсорса - пусть идут лесом, пусть докажут сначала, что это было именно так.
добавлено спустя 2 минуты:
Цитировать
Почему бесплатно ? Свободно .
Ты можешь продавть свою программу , но обязан прилагать
исходники (GPL) .
И если код под GPL , то переходя на коммерческую версию
ты не должен делать его закрытым .
Переписывай.
Так я и не закрываю GPL код. То, что было опенсурсовым, таким же и остается.
А то, что я уже наворачию дополнительно, с купленной лицензией, я закрываю, верно?
В конце концов, у Троллей тоже двойственная политика
Записан
What is the 11 in the C++11? It’s the number of feet they glued to C++ trying to obtain a better octopus.
COVID не волк, в лес не уйдёт
Dimchansky
Гость
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#172 :
Май 22, 2007, 22:56 »
Цитата: "Racheengel"
Ну, естественно - в их интересах вытрясти с тебя как можно больше денег
А вот за оплату опенсорса - пусть идут лесом, пусть докажут сначала, что это было именно так.
Так они тебе просто коммерческую лицензию могут не продать. Хотя.. может это только угрозы, чтобы ты пораньше платить начал.
добавлено спустя 1 минуту:
Цитата: "kitov"
Нет , ошибаюсь .
Если используется только твой , личный код , то разумеется
можно брать любую лицензию.
А если ты перепишешь чужой GPL-ный код или купишь аналогичный закрытый, то то же самое.
Записан
Racheengel
Джедай : наставник для всех
Offline
Сообщений: 2679
Я работал с дискетам 5.25 :(
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#173 :
Май 22, 2007, 23:09 »
Вряд ли у них есть законные основания в отказе от продажи лицензии.
Это уже дело подсудное...
Записан
What is the 11 in the C++11? It’s the number of feet they glued to C++ trying to obtain a better octopus.
COVID не волк, в лес не уйдёт
Dimchansky
Гость
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#174 :
Май 22, 2007, 23:27 »
Тогда осталось подождать, что они напишут по поводу тог, что же именно нарушается при переходе с OpenSource на Commercial.
Записан
DiNick
Гость
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#175 :
Май 23, 2007, 16:15 »
Вот читаю читаю ветку и возникает вопрос
Есть ли у кого перевод на русский Qt лицензии... :arrow:
Если есть то надо перечитать и понять всетаки как переходить с открытого на коммерческий
Записан
Racheengel
Джедай : наставник для всех
Offline
Сообщений: 2679
Я работал с дискетам 5.25 :(
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#176 :
Май 23, 2007, 19:34 »
Очень просто переходить.
Все, что ты сделал в открытом коде - оставь как есть (т.е. открытым).
Если ты нигде еще этот код не публиковал - считай, что его нет
То есть дальнейшая разработка с купленной лицензией никому не повредит.
Если опубликовал - оставь этот код открытым. А все остальное можешь закрывать. Например, следующий релиз с новыми функциями.
Записан
What is the 11 in the C++11? It’s the number of feet they glued to C++ trying to obtain a better octopus.
COVID не волк, в лес не уйдёт
goer
Гость
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#177 :
Май 23, 2007, 19:38 »
2Racheengel. А если я просто возьму чужые открытые сорцы и закрою их и буду пидалить под лицензеей?
Записан
Racheengel
Джедай : наставник для всех
Offline
Сообщений: 2679
Я работал с дискетам 5.25 :(
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#178 :
Май 23, 2007, 19:43 »
Я думаю, этот вопрос надо задавать автору этих сорцов
Если он не против - почему бы нет?
В своем посте я подразумевал, что сырцы собственные. Следовательно, ты можешь делать с ними что хочешь.
Записан
What is the 11 in the C++11? It’s the number of feet they glued to C++ trying to obtain a better octopus.
COVID не волк, в лес не уйдёт
kitov
Гость
Re: Qt: FAQ о лицензии. Commercial vs Opensource
«
Ответ #179 :
Май 23, 2007, 20:12 »
Цитата: "goer"
2Racheengel. А если я просто возьму чужые открытые сорцы и закрою их и буду пидалить под лицензеей?
В суд подадут .
Записан
Страниц:
1
...
10
11
[
12
]
13
14
...
30
Вверх
Печать
« предыдущая тема
следующая тема »
Перейти в:
Пожалуйста, выберите назначение:
-----------------------------
Qt
-----------------------------
=> Вопросы новичков
=> Уроки и статьи
=> Установка, сборка, отладка, тестирование
=> Общие вопросы
=> Пользовательский интерфейс (GUI)
=> Qt Quick
=> Model-View (MV)
=> Базы данных
=> Работа с сетью
=> Многопоточное программирование, процессы
=> Мультимедиа
=> 2D и 3D графика
=> OpenGL
=> Печать
=> Интернационализация, локализация
=> QSS
=> XML
=> Qt Script, QtWebKit
=> ActiveX
=> Qt Embedded
=> Дополнительные компоненты
=> Кладовая готовых решений
=> Вклад сообщества в Qt
=> Qt-инструментарий
-----------------------------
Программирование
-----------------------------
=> Общий
=> С/C++
=> Python
=> Алгоритмы
=> Базы данных
=> Разработка игр
-----------------------------
Компиляторы и платформы
-----------------------------
=> Linux
=> Windows
=> Mac OS X
=> Компиляторы
===> Visual C++
-----------------------------
Разное
-----------------------------
=> Новости
===> Новости Qt сообщества
===> Новости IT сферы
=> Говорилка
=> Юмор
=> Объявления
Загружается...